                        I am re-purposing my saree guard with foot rest as side hook for carrying luggage. Will elaborate on this a bit. We know we all love riding and thats the primary reason we have got 160 4V. But there are practical aspects of life, especially when you are a family man. Fortunately 1604v is more practical among other bikes in this category when it comes to seat space, riding posture etc. Regarding luggage I always keep a cloth bag and a plastic clip (used for hanging clothes to dry) under my seat tucked towards left side of seat cowl, without obstructing air flow to air filter. When I have luggage I put it in the cloth bag, place it firmly on the foot rest of saree guard and tie a knot using the carry handles of the bag to the top most horizontal bar of saree guard and secure it using the clip.

                                Congratulations and happy riding!! Sticking below 3K RPM for 1000 Kms is going to really test your patience I would say keep 4000-4200 as a realistic limit. You can cruise comfortably at 55 Kmph in 5th gear at 4K rpm without stressing the engine at all.
